Torla and Smorla and The Deeper than Average Hole is a laugh-out-loud, heartwarming tale of two lovable giraffes and their unshakeable friendship. Packed with humour, kindness, and a few unexpected twists, this delightful story shows just how far friends will go to help one another - even when faced with a rather unusual challenge!
Meet Torla, the taller-than-average giraffe, and Smorla, who is... well, smaller than average. In The Deeper than Average Hole, Smorla must figure out how to rescue her friend, but despite her best efforts, Torla remains resolutely stuck.How will Smorla get her out?! Featuring two stronger-than-average elephants, one hairier-than-average gorilla, and a BIG surprise, this book is packed with uproarious deadpan humour that will have kids and grown-ups giggling as they turn the pages.
Beyond the laughs, The Deeper than Average Hole teaches children the importance of persistence and helping others as Smorla works tirelessly to save her friend Torla from a tricky situation. This lovable series will get children thinking about the world around them in a fun and engaging way.
This is the second book in a laugh-out-loud series by Kes Gray, with bright and witty illustrations from award-winning artist Chris Jevons. Designed in a unique, narrowed portrait format to emphasise the giraffes' height and the hole's depth, this playful picture book includes four gatefolds, offering a special and interactive reading experience that actively engages children.
At times whimsical and at others hilarious, this series by Kes Gray follows Torla and Smorla on their extraordinary adventures. Their love and trust take their unlikely friendship to exciting new heights.

About the Author
Kes Gray is a British author who exploded onto the shelves in 2000 with his debut and prize-winning picture book, Eat Your Peas. He has since published more than twenty-five Daisy books, with sales topping more than a million copies. In 2014, his picture book phenomenon Oi Frog! spawned the most popular picture book series of recent times, with sales of over 2.5 million copies worldwide. Chris Jevons is an award-winning UK-based children's picture book illustrator with a passion for character design and storytelling. He began his career studying Art and Design at college and 3D Animation at university. Chris has illustrated books for fantastic authors including Peter Bently, Maz Evans, Lucy Rowland and Kes Gray. Chris' most recent books include: Goldilocks in Space, My Daddy is Hilarious, 101 Bums, 101 Spooky Bums, Superpoop, Onesie Party and The Exploding Life of Scarlett Fife.
